C#中ComboBox的SelectedIndexChanged事件获取Tag值

 

DataTable table = new DataTable;

 

/// <summary>
        /// 点击Cmb控件时获取Tag值
        /// </summary>
        /// <param name="sender"></param>
        /// <param name="e"></param>

private void cmbChoice_SelectedIndexChanged(object sender, EventArgs e)

{

        DataRow rows = table.Select("绑定显示字段= '" + cmbChoice.SelectedItem.ToString() + "'")[0];
            cmbChoice.Tag = rows["绑定值ID"].ToString();

}

 

/// <summary>
        /// 获取到ComboBoxTag值后进行其他操作
        /// </summary>
        /// <returns></returns>

public void GetInfo()

{

string cmbtag = cmbChoice.Tag;  //获取到当前选中的值

}

 

posted @ 2015-09-14 16:28  新城已无在少年  阅读(1757)  评论(0编辑  收藏  举报